Alibaba and Tencent are by far the most valuable Chinese brands, according to the latest report from BrandZ. They both registered a calculated brand value of over $100bn, with Alibaba marginally ahead. This contrasts with third-placed ICBC, at just $40.7bn.
Among the top ten, technology brands fared best, placing second (Tencent), sixth (Huawei) and eighth (Baidu). Retail and banking registered two brands in the top ten, Alibaba and JD for the former and ICBC and China Construction Bank for the latter.
